Abstract

PURPOSE:To install a ventilator simply on a fellow panel without narrowing the opening width of vent ducts. CONSTITUTION:Plural vent ducts 24 are formed integrally on a synthetic resinous cover plate 23 so as to protrude inside of a vehicle body panel 21. An exhaust valve 27 is arranged in an air exhaust port 26 of the vent duct 24, and air on the indoor side A is introduced to the outdoor side B. A locking claw 30 locked on an inside surface of the vehicle body panel 21 is arranged protrusively on a side wall 24b of the vent duct 24. A U-shaped slit 31 is formed in the side wall 24b around the locking claw 30, and flexibility is given to the locking claw 30. The cover plate 23 is joined to the vehicle body panel 21 from the outdoor side B, and an intermediate part of the cover plate 23 is installed on the vehicle body panel 21 by the locking claw 30.

B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a ventilator for ventilating the interior of a vehicle or a building, for example, and more particularly to improvement of a mounting structure for an opening of a mating panel.

2. Description of the Related Art As shown in FIG. 9, a conventional automobile ventilator includes a synthetic resin cover plate 53 for covering an opening 52 of a vehicle body panel 51. Cover plate 5
3, a plurality of vent ducts 54 for guiding the air in the interior A of the automobile to the exterior B are integrally formed, and a rubber exhaust valve 56 is attached to an exhaust port 55 thereof. The cover plate 53 is attached to the vehicle body panel 51 with the four screws 57 on the upper, lower, left and right sides. Further, in the conventional ventilation device shown in FIG. 10, a latching claw 58 is projectingly provided on the cover plate 53 at the side of the vent duct 54, and the latching claw 58 is latched on the inner surface of the vehicle body panel during mounting. However, according to the conventional example of FIG. 9, since the cover plate 53 is attached to the vehicle body panel 51 by the four screws 57, not only the man-hours required for attachment increase but also the vehicle body It was also necessary to machine a large number of screw holes 59 in the panel 51. Further, according to the conventional example of FIG. 10, since the latching claw 58 is provided so as to project to the side of the vent duct 54, there is a problem in that the opening width W of the vent duct 54 becomes narrow and ventilation efficiency decreases. Therefore, an object of the present invention is to provide a ventilation device which can be easily attached to a mating panel without narrowing the opening width of the vent duct.

In order to solve the above-mentioned problems, the ventilator of the present invention has a cover plate made of synthetic resin covering an opening of a mating panel, and a vent duct for guiding indoor air to the outside. It is integrally formed so as to project to the inside of the mating panel, and a side wall of the vent duct is provided with a latching claw that is latched to the inner surface of the mating panel and a slit that imparts flexibility to the latching claw. In the ventilating apparatus of the present invention, when the cover plate is joined to the mating panel, the slits act to restore the latching claws to the inside of the vent duct and restore the latching to the inner surface of the mating panel. Therefore, screws are not required in this portion, and the number of screw tightening steps can be reduced, and the ventilation device can be attached to the mating panel with good workability. Further, since the hooking claw is provided on the side wall of the vent duct, there is no fear that the opening width of the vent duct becomes narrow.

DETAILED DESCRIPTION OF THE PREFERRED EMBODIMENTS An embodiment in which the present invention is embodied in an automobile ventilation system will be described below with reference to FIGS. The ventilator of this embodiment includes a cover plate 23 made of synthetic resin that covers the opening 22 of the vehicle body panel 21, and two inner and outer reinforcing ribs 23a project from the entire circumference of the cover plate 23. Inside the a, the cover plate 23 is integrally formed with four upper and lower vent ducts 24 so as to project to the inside of the vehicle body panel 21.

Each of the vent ducts 24 is formed in a pocket shape from a guide wall 24a which is curved and rises from the outdoor B side to the indoor A side, and a pair of side walls 24b which face each other, and has an intake port 25 on the indoor A side. An exhaust port 26 is provided on the outdoor B side. The exhaust port 26 is covered with an exhaust valve 27 made of rubber, and an upper edge portion of the exhaust valve 27 is attached to an outer surface of the cover plate 23 via a retainer 28.

The vent duct 24 has an exhaust valve 27.
By this action, the air in the room A is guided to the room B, and the air in the room B is not introduced into the room A. Further, the vent duct 24 also functions as a water return for returning the water that has entered when the exhaust valve 27 is opened to the outside B due to the shape of the guide wall 24a.

A locking claw 30 having a triangular cross section that is locked to the inner surface of the vehicle body panel 21 is provided on the outer surface 4b so as to project outward. In addition, a U-shaped slit 31 that gives flexibility to the hooks 30 is formed on the side wall 24b around the hooks 30. The middle portion of the cover plate 23 is attached to the vehicle body panel 21 by the hooks 30, and the upper and lower ends of the cover plate 23 are fastened with screws 32.
It can be tightened to 1. 2 and 3, reference numeral 33 is a packing interposed between the vehicle body panel 21 and the cover plate 23.

When the ventilator constructed as described above is attached to the vehicle body panel 21, the cover plate 23 is joined to the vehicle body panel 21 from the outside B side to form the vent duct 2
4 into the opening 22. Then, the latch claw 30 engages with the peripheral edge of the opening 22 and bends to the inside of the vent duct 24 by the action of the slit 31. Then, the latch claw 30 has the opening 2
Immediately after passing through 2, the latching claw 30 is restored to the outside of the vent duct 24 by the action of the slit 31, and the vehicle body panel 21
It is hooked on the inner surface of the. Therefore, in this state, if the upper and lower ends of the cover plate 23 are fastened with the screws 32, it is possible to firmly attach the upper, middle and lower parts of the ventilation device to the vehicle body panel 21, respectively.

As described above, according to the ventilator of the present embodiment, the screw in the middle portion of the cover plate 23 is unnecessary, and the total number of screw tightening steps can be reduced, so that the ventilator can be mounted on the vehicle body panel 21 easily. Can be installed well.
Further, since the latch claw 30 is provided on the side wall 24b,
It is possible to improve the ventilation efficiency by designing the opening width W of the vent duct 24 wide.

FIGS. 5 to 8 show another embodiment of the ventilation device for an automobile, in which the shape of the slit which gives flexibility to the hook is different from that of the above embodiment. In this embodiment, an L-shaped slit 35 and a vertically long slit 36 are provided on the side wall 24b of the vent duct 24. The L-shaped slit 35 is formed around the latch claw 30, and the vertically long slit 36 is cut downward from the upper surface of the side wall 24b at a position apart from the latch claw 30.
The other structure is the same as that of the above-mentioned embodiment, and the same reference numerals are given to the respective drawings and the description thereof is omitted.
